Buhru (Lizardfolk)

The Buhru are a race of reptilian humanoids that are native to the Serpent Isles (better known as the Blue Flame Isles). Buhru are a little bulkier than humans and their colorful frills make them appear even larger, but they tend to be shorter than humans.

ability score increase: Your Constitution score increases by 2, and your Wisdom score increases by 1.
age: The typical life span of a Buhru character is about a century, maturing at a similar rate to humans.

Size: Medium
speed: 30 ft., swim 30 ft.
Languages: You can speak, read, and write Common and one regional language.
race features:
Swim Speed. You have a swimming speed of 30 feet.
Bite. Your fanged maw is a natural weapon, which you can use to make unarmed strikes. If you hit with it, you deal piercing damage equal to 1d6 + your Strength modifier, instead of the bludgeoning damage normal for an unarmed strike.
Cunning Artisan. As part of a short rest, you can harvest bone and hide from a slain beast, construct, dragon, monstrosity, or plant creature of size small or larger to create one of the following items: a shield, a club, a javelin, or 1d4 darts or blowgun needles. To use this trait, you need a blade, such as a dagger, or appropriate artisan's tools, such as leatherworker's tools. Note: these items might not be of the same durability of properly crafted weapons and have a chance of breaking.
Hold Breath. You can hold your breath for up to 15 minutes at a time.
Hunter's Lore. You gain proficiency with two of the following skills of your choice: Animal Handling, Nature, Perception, Stealth, and Survival.
Natural Armor. You have tough, scaly skin. When you aren't wearing armor, your AC is 13 + your Dexterity modifier. You can use your natural armor to determine your AC if the armor you wear would leave you with a lower AC. A shield's benefits apply as normal while you use your natural armor.
Hungry Jaws. In battle, you can throw yourself into a vicious feeding frenzy. As a bonus action, you can make a special attack with your bite. If the attack hits, it deals its normal damage, and you gain temporary hit points equal to your Constitution modifier (minimum of 1), and you can't use this trait again until you finish a short or long rest.
Buhru of the Blue Flames Isles
The Buhru's ancient culture is highly respected, reflected, and sometimes imitated in the daily life of Bilgewater—including traditional medicine, and monster hunting techniques. The native's peoples' knowledge of the ocean and its denizens in these parts is second to none; most ships rely on at least one Buhru to guide their vessel through the perilous straits around Bilgewater. As such, those that leave their more traditional homes and join Bilgewater's fleets often rise their way to key roles.
